A vehicle approaches a set of traffic lights with a speed of 15m/s. When 50m from the lights the driver brakes and comes to a re
sattari [20]

Answer:

–2.25 m/s²

Explanation:

From the question given above, the following data were obtained:

Initial velocity (u) = 15 m/s

Distance travelled (s) = 50 m

Final velocity (v) = 0 m/s

Deceleration (a) =?

v² = u² + 2as

0² = 15² + (2 × a × 50)

0 = 225 + 100a

Collect like terms

0 – 225 = 100a

– 225 = 100a

Divide both side by 100

a = –225/100

a = –2.25 m/s²

Thus, the deceleration of the vehicle is –2.25 m/s²
